The control firefighter�s major perform is to assure that the correct quantity of hose is stretched so that the nozzle reaches the seat of the fireplace. It is critical that this member have the expertise and knowledge to appropriately estimate the variety of lengths of hose required for the type of stretch ordered by the officer. Excessive hose increases each friction loss and the potential for kinks which might trigger a substantial discount in each circulate (gpm) and stream quality (compactness and reach) at the nozzle. Kinks additionally require higher engine pressures which increases the potential for a burst size. Where attainable, only essentially the most skilled and educated firefighters ought to be assigned the control position. If a door was to close over a dry hoseline that was subsequently charged, it will be extraordinarily troublesome to free the hose and may result in a drastic discount in circulate. This could require repositioning of hose in halls and stairways and straightening any bends which are restricting the water circulate. It must be o remembered that a single ninety kink in an 1 3/four inch hoseline may end up in a lack of 20 gpm or more. Successive kinks in a hoseline produces an accumulative have an effect on on lowering circulate and a hoseline with 3 kinks, for example, might lose ninety gpm or more, leading to an ineffective and unsafe fire stream. More lives are saved at fire operations by the correct positioning and working of hoselines than by all other life saving techniques out there to the firefighting forces. The majority of structural fires are managed and extinguished by this initial line. This is accomplished by stretching the hoseline through the first technique of egress, usually the main stairway. In most cases the primary line is stretched through the interior stairs to the situation of the fireplace. The objective of this line is to shield the first technique of egress for occupants evacuating the building and to confine and extinguish the fireplace. An exception to stretching the primary line up the interior stairs could also be made when flame is issuing from home windows opening onto the fireplace escape and endangering individuals attempting to come down the fireplace escape. In this case the primary line could also be operated from the street to shield individuals on the fireplace escape. Lines must be stretched to shield life first and in the absence of a life hazard, the primary line ought to be positioned to shield the greatest amount of property. When placing a hoseline to shield an exterior exposure, it ought to be positioned in order that the stream can be used alternately between working on the exposure and the fireplace. When using streams to shield uncovered buildings, the water ought to be applied onto the building�s floor for best outcomes. Studies show that rectal diazepam could be a safe and effective treatment for acute repetitive or extended seizures. Although intravenous diazepam can produce serious respiratory despair, printed studies of rectal diazepam have found no cases of significant respiratory despair. Other unwanted effects that have been reported embody dizziness, headache, poor coordination, ache, nervousness, slowed speech, diarrhea, and rash. The most commonly prescribed form is Diastat, a rectal gel that comes pre-packaged as a quick delivery set in a syringe with a versatile, molded tip. It involves the insertion of a tool much like a pacemaker beneath the skin on the left facet of the chest. This vagal nerve stimulator can send intermittent electrical indicators to the mind by stimulating the left vagus nerve in the neck. The vagus nerve is among the cranial nerves that controls the muscular tissues liable for swallowing, coughing and voice sounds. Seizure exercise could enhance immediately, or it might enhance over a two-12 months time interval the vagal nerve stimulator works in two methods. It can be activated to give extra stimulations manually between pre programmed stimulations by putting a magnet over the stimulator after which eradicating the magnet. Programming of the generator is accomplished with a wand connected to a pc on the doctor�s workplace.
